A Marine Paradise in the Heart of Indonesia

Nestled in the remote reaches of Indonesia, the Wakatobi Islands are a true tropical paradise waiting to be discovered. This archipelago, with its crystal-clear waters, vibrant coral reefs, and rich marine biodiversity, is a haven for divers, snorkelers, and nature enthusiasts. Beyond its underwater wonders, Wakatobi offers a unique blend of culture, sustainable tourism, and natural beauty that sets it apart as a gem in Southeast Asia.

Sustainable Tourism:

Wakatobi is a pioneer in sustainable tourism and marine conservation.

Wakatobi National Park:

Discover the Wakatobi National Park, a UNESCO World Biosphere Reserve dedicated to preserving marine ecosystems.

Local Conservation Efforts:

Engage with local initiatives that protect sea turtles, coral reefs, and traditional fishing practices.

Cultural Experiences:

Wakatobi’s culture is deeply rooted in the sea and local traditions.

Local Villages:

Visit remote villages like Wangi-Wangi, Kaledupa, Tomia, and Binongko to learn about the Bajo people, also known as sea gypsies.

Traditional Craftsmanship:

Witness the artistry of local craftsmen who produce handwoven textiles and wooden boats.

Gastronomic Delights:

Sample the flavors of Wakatobi, a blend of fresh seafood and traditional Indonesian cuisine.

Bajo Cuisine:

Indulge in Bajo cuisine, which includes dishes like ikan bakar (grilled fish) and bubur tinutuan (a hearty porridge).
